The Cardinals inked left handed relief pitcher Randy Flores to a two year deal for $1.8 million. Flores was pretty unspectacular in the regular season in 2006, his third with the Cardinals. He walked 22 batters in 41 2/3 innings as a left handed specialist and his ERA was a pedestrian 5.62. He did make up for it in the post season though. He didn’t give up a single run in 5 2/3 innings and he saw action in the three of the Cardinals wins against the Mets.
This is a solid signing as long as Tony LaRussa uses Flores the right way, which is almost exclusively against left handed hitters. Right handed batters hit .329 against Flores last season vs. the .258 that left handers hit against him.
